Companies Law

1. The shares of a joint-stock company shall be nominal and indivisible against
the company. If a share is owned by several persons, they shall choose one
person from among themselves to represent them in the use of rights related
thereto. Said persons shall be jointly and severally liable for obligations
arising from the ownership of such share.
2. The company's articles of association shall specify the nominal value of its
shares; shares of the same type or class shall be of equal nominal value.
3. Subject to paragraph (2) of this Article, shares may be divided into shares of
a lower nominal value or merged in order to become shares of a higher
nominal value. The Competent Authority may set the rules necessary
therefor.
4. An unlisted joint-stock company shall issue a paper or electronic certificate
establishing the shareholder's ownership of the share.
